Euhomy unveiled the Ice Leopard X1 at CES 2026, and the company claims it is the world's fastest portable ice maker, able to produce nine bullet ice cubes — about one cup — in five minutes.

ZDNET's Alison DeNisco Rayome saw the machine at CES and described it as a surprisingly slim unit with a countertop footprint similar to a coffee maker. The ice bucket is removable and comes with a lid that a company representative said will keep ice cold for four hours; filling the bucket completely takes about an hour.

The Ice Leopard X1 will be available in April and will cost $150. The metal base comes in four colors and the bucket in eight, and the bucket is dishwasher safe; DeNisco Rayome said the price struck her as low compared with similar kitchen gadgets.

ZDNET noted another rapid ice maker at CES: Govee's GoveeLife Smart Nugget Ice Maker Pro, which makes nugget ice in six minutes but is much larger, described as more sophisticated, and retails for $500.
